Transaction 432585301ea3b7843adcccaf4cbca02357e4097ef1f8fea2c6623d0c43e2cfaa
1 Input
1 Output
-
432585301ea3b7843adcccaf4cbca02357e4097ef1f8fea2c6623d0c43e2cfaa:0
- value
- 255900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1263f55406af15ca410ac9abe55d8d9182dafc79 OP_EQUAL
- address
- 33NFqDqJrPSMw2q4feEvYqqxC1peMBARQi